How do you write the standard equation of a circle?

The standard form of a circle's equation is (x-h)2 + (y-k)2 = r2 where (h,k) is the center and r is the radius. To convert an equation to standard form, you can always complete the square separately in x and y.

What are the circle theorems rules?

  • The angle at the centre is twice the angle at the circumference.
  • The angle in a semicircle is a right angle.
  • Angles in the same segment are equal.
  • Opposite angles in a cyclic quadrilateral sum to 180°

How do you find the equation of a circle on a graph?

The equation of a circle appears as (x – h) 2 + (y – v) 2 = r 2 . This is called the center-radius form (or standard form) because it gives you both pieces of information at the same time. The h and v represent the coordinates of the center of the circle being at the point (h, v), and r represents the radius.

How do you find the equation of a line?

  1. Find the slope using the slope formula. ...
  2. Use the slope and one of the points to solve for the y-intercept (b). ...
  3. Once you know the value for m and the value for b, you can plug these into the slope-intercept form of a line (y = mx + b) to get the equation for the line.
